The entry of air through the blind box in Spanish homes has become a critical point for energy efficiency and public health. Architecture and construction experts warn that this lack of tightness not only increases the electricity and gas bill by losing between 30% and 40% of the heat, but also acts as an “open door” to structural and respiratory pathologies due to condensation and the appearance of mold inside the homes.
The origin of this problem lies mainly in the absence of insulating material inside conventional drawers, especially those made of thin PVC or wood. As the specialists explain, the design of the blind generates a direct connection with the outside.
“Many times we take for granted that our window is good and that the drawer already has its own insulation, but that is not the case,” says the expert from the specialized channel. Building Houses.
A high risk for your pocket (and health)
The impact of a poorly sealed drawer is multidimensional. On the economic side, heating and air conditioning must work twice as hard to stabilize the temperature, which is a constant waste. Socially, the comfort It is diminished by noise pollution and the whistles produced by the wind when filtered through the conveyor belt.
However, the most severe risk is health. The temperature difference between the cold air outside and the warm air inside generates condensation. This accumulated humidity is the ideal breeding ground for fungal colonies. “Breathing mold spores can cause or aggravate asthma, allergies and other lung conditions,” health experts warn.
Quick and easy solutions
To address this situation, professionals recommend simple but effective interventions. The installation of reflective insulation sheets, a multipurpose material that takes up little thickness, is presented as the most efficient option for renovations. “It is a material that is entering the market strongly; when we see a work, our eyes go to the insulation that shines,” they highlight from Building Houses.
Among the recommended measures to improve watertightness, the following stand out:
- Insulate the interior of the drawer: Place self-adhesive thermal-acoustic insulating panels.
- Motorization: Eliminate the tape to eliminate the main air entry point.
- Sealing joints: Apply silicone or polyurethane foam to the cracks in the lid.
Keeping the mechanism clean and sealed not only protects the well-being of the tenants, but also prevents premature deterioration of the hardware due to the entry of dust and pollution, guaranteeing a longer useful life of the domestic infrastructure.
